WINDWARD PLANNING COMMISSION <br />COUNTY OF HAWAII <br />HEARING TRANSCRIPT <br />DECEMBER 1, 2016 <br />A regularly advertised hearing on the request to revoke Use Permit No. 204 (Kukuihaele <br />Plantation House LLC) was called to order at 9:10 a.m. in the County of Hawaii Aupuni <br />Center Conference Room, 101 Pauahi Street, Hilo, Hawaii with Chairman Gregory Henkel <br />presiding. <br />COMMISSIONERS PRESENT: Joseph Clarkson, Donn Dela Cruz, Gregory Henkel, Donald <br />Ikeda, and Raylene Moses. <br />ABSENT & EXCUSED: Myles Miyasato. <br />ALSO PRESENT: Duane Kanuha (Planning Director), Malia Ho (Deputy Corporation Counsel <br />for the Windward Planning Commission), Daryn Arai (Planning Program Manager), Jeff Darrow <br />(Staff Planner), Maija Jackson (Staff Planner), Christian Kay (Staff Planner), and Sarah <br />Hata-Finley (Commission Secretary). <br />And 7 members from the public in attendance. <br />APPLICANT: KUKUIHAELE PLANTATION HOUSE LLC (Revoke USE No. 204) <br />Request to revoke Use Permit No. 204 originally approved on April 1, 2005 and issued to World <br />Healing Institute to allow the establishment of a children's convalescent facility on <br />approximately 31 acres of land within the Resort -Hotel -25,000 square foot per unit (V-25) <br />zoning district. The area involves the site of the formerly proposed Trees of Kukuihaele <br />development located within Kukuihaele and makai of the Honoka`a-Waipi`o Road (Highway <br />240) and the Old Government Road at Waikoekoe and Kanahonua, Hamakua, Hawaii, <br />TMKs: 4-8-006:003, 013 & 069. <br />HENKEL: With that, we can move on to Item No. 2, the Kukuihaele Plantation House, LLC, <br />revoke USE 204, and Jeffrey Darrow will be presenting. <br />DARROW: Thank you, Mr. Chairman.
